Plot Summary
The film accompanies a motley crew of idealists on board the Greenpeace ship "Esperanza" on their mission to prevent the Japanese whaling fleet from hunting the endangered animals in the Arctic Ocean. The documentary shows how the Esperanza attempts to pick up the trail of the whalers in the endless expanses of the Southern Ocean, who for their part want to avoid a confrontation. Using tiny inflatable boats, the animal rights activists try to obstruct the fleet as much as possible, risking their lives. A race against time begins. Angela Graas' film largely dispenses with gory images and simple black-and-white imagery.
